The Water-Energy Crisis in Kenyan Agriculture

Imagine being a Kenyan farmer watching your crops wither under relentless sun while knowing water sits untapped just meters below your feet. This frustrating paradox affects 80% of Kenya's farmland reliant on rain-fed agriculture. Traditional diesel pumps? They devour 40% of operating costs in fuel alone. That's where SunCulture Kenya for sale changes the equation - turning abundant sunshine into liquid gold for crops.

Inside the Technology: Solar Pumps & Smart Monitoring

Component Function Innovation
280W Solar Panel Energy generation Self-cleaning coating reduces dust loss by 18%
IoT Controller System management Remote monitoring via SMS alerts
Battery Backup Energy storage Optional 48V lithium-ion integration

Real Impact: Data from Kenyan Farms

Consider Mwea Irrigation Scheme's 2023 trial with 120 SunCulture installations:

  • 🔼 73% average yield increase for maize crops
  • 🔽 55% reduction in water consumption
  • 💰 Payback period: 14 months (vs 5+ years for diesel)

These numbers explain why the Kenyan government now subsidizes 30% of solar pump costs. As World Bank data confirms, solar irrigation could boost East Africa's agricultural GDP by $1.3B annually.
